When considering wooden decks, choosing the best kind of wood is essential. Below is a list of common kinds of wood utilized for Porch Improvement setups, in addition to their qualities:
Cedar
Naturally resistant to decay and pests.Pleasant aroma and attractive grain pattern.Lightweight and easy to work with.
Redwood
Deals lovely natural hues.Highly resistant to wetness and pests.More expensive than other options.
Pressure-Treated Pine
Economical and commonly readily available.Treated to withstand rot and pests.Needs maintenance to prevent warping.
Ipe

The installation of a wooden porch is not a DIY job for the majority of house owners. Properly building a porch needs a skilled installer to ensure it's safe and fulfills building codes. Below is a detailed overview of the normal installation process:
1. Preparation and DesignAssess your area and figure out the size and design of the porch.Pick the kind of wood based on your budget plan, visual choices, and maintenance determination.2. AllowingContact your local building authority to determine if you require a license for construction.Ensure that all designs and plans adhere to local building codes.3. Preparing the SiteClear the area where the porch will be installed.Level the ground and create a strong structure, whether it's a concrete footing or piers.4. Framing the PorchBuild A Porch the frame using pressure-treated wood to resist rot.Add joists and assistance beams, ensuring everything is level and secure.5. Installing FlooringLay down the wooden slabs, enabling for correct spacing for drainage and growth.Protect the planks with screws for longevity.6. Adding Railings and Other FeaturesInclude railings, steps, and other design functions according to your preferences.Guarantee all elements comply with safety guidelines.7. How long does it take to install a wooden porch?
The installation time depends upon the porch size and design complexity. Typically, it takes between 2-5 days.
2. What is the average cost of setting up a wooden porch?
On average, expenses can range from ₤ 15 to ₤ 50 per square foot, including materials and labor. This can vary based on wood type and design complexity.
3. How can I ensure my wooden porch is constructed to last?
Picking top quality products, working with experienced installers, and committing to routine upkeep will enhance the longevity of your porch.
4. Can I install a wooden porch myself?
While skilled DIY lovers may consider it, professional installation is recommended for guaranteeing security and adherence to building regulations.
5. What kind of wood is best for a wooden porch in a rainy climate?
Cedar and redwood are excellent choices due to their natural resistance to moisture and decay.
